What is the RIGHT niche for you?

I have seen some great websites on everything from food receipts to travel to pet care. These folk have really found their niche. They post length articles on something you can tell is their passion. I have reviewed a few great websites on various online produces and service. These website owners have done their homework before creating their posts.

This is where things should come into view. Ask yourself a few questions when creating your next post or thinking of the RIGHT niche for you.

  • Is this a niche I have knowledge on?
  • Do i enjoy researching this niche?
  • Is the niche going to interest others?
  • What niche have I always wants to share with others?
  • Is this niche my niche?

If you can honestly sit back and relax for 10 minute and think about each of these questions. You just may very well find the Niche that is Right for YOU..
